Where each one falls short

Documented limitations, not opinions. Every one is a constraint you would hit in normal use.

Cosign

  • Keyless signing inherits every weakness of the identity provider behind it. Sigstore’s own threat model states that if an identity provider is compromised, Sigstore will issue certificates to those identities, so a compromised account produces perfectly valid signatures.
  • A signature proves who signed, never whether they should have. The documentation is explicit that Sigstore cannot determine authorisation, so every consumer must write and maintain their own identity and issuer policy or verification means nothing.
  • Nothing is enforced without an admission controller. Signing changes what you can prove, not what runs, and the official policy controller has a small maintainer base for a component sitting in a cluster admission path.
  • Upgrades break pipelines. Version 3 changed defaults, version 4 is announced as removing legacy functionality and roughly half the command line flags, and two official client libraries still lacked support for the new log format as of mid 2026.
  • Signatures do not expire. An artifact signed before a maintainer account was compromised and one signed after are indistinguishable unless somebody is actively monitoring the transparency log, and almost nobody is.

Passbolt

  • Pro Edition requires a minimum of 10 users, making it costlier for very small teams.
  • Community Edition lacks SSO and LDAP provisioning, which many organizations need for onboarding at scale.
  • Self-hosting the Community Edition requires infrastructure and maintenance effort compared to fully managed competitors.
  • Enterprise-tier support and HA consulting require custom, quote-based pricing rather than transparent rates.

Answered from the vendors’ own pages

Cosign: Does Cosign tell me if an image is vulnerable?

No. It has no vulnerability knowledge whatsoever. It can carry an SBOM as a signed attestation but never reads it. Pair it with a scanner.

Passbolt: Is Passbolt free to use?

Yes. The Community Edition is free forever with unlimited users, including password sharing, folders, groups, role-based access, browser extensions, a CLI, and an open API.

Cosign: Is signing alone enough?

No. Verification is a command somebody runs. Without an admission controller enforcing it, an unsigned image still runs.

Passbolt: What does the Pro Edition cost and add?

Pro Edition costs $4.90 per user per month billed annually, with a 10-user minimum, and adds LDAP/AD provisioning, single sign-on, account recovery escrow, activity audit logs, and next-business-day support.

Cosign: What does a bare cosign verify actually prove?

Very little. Without a pinned certificate identity and OIDC issuer, it accepts a valid signature from any identity at all.

Passbolt: What license is Passbolt distributed under?

All Passbolt editions, including Pro and Enterprise, are distributed under the AGPL v3 open-source license.

Cosign: What is the risk of keyless signing?

Your OIDC provider becomes the root of trust. Compromise of that account yields genuine, verifiable signatures, so account security is the control that matters.

Cosign: Should we expect breaking changes?

Yes. Version 4 is announced to remove roughly half the flags, and a post-quantum migration is named as a further breaking change after that.
